Perceiving the 'Eco' in Eco-friendly Pool Design

When we talk about eco-friendly pool designs, what does it exactly entail? Is it merely about reducing energy consumption, or is there more to it?

An eco-friendly pool design is primarily about decreasing the environmental footprint of your pool, backed by ethical sourcing and sustainable technology. It includes low energy consumption, chemical-free cleansing, efficient water management, sustainable sourcing, and nature-inspired aesthetics. An eco-friendly pool isn't just better for the environment; it’s healthier for you and your family, offering the added allure of lower maintenance needs.

Components of an Eco-friendly Pool Design

An eco-friendly pool design holistically incorporates various components. Ranging from energy-efficient technology, heating techniques, water conservation approaches, to sustainable source materials.

The crux lies in understanding and judiciously selecting the technologies and materials suited to your context. From solar-powered pool pumps, environmentally-friendly heaters, rainwater tanks, to recycled construction materials, a thoughtful approach can contribute towards an efficient design.

Pros and Cons of an Eco-friendly Pool Design

Like every design decision, choosing to go 'Eco' with your pool also incorporates several advantages and challenges. These range from the environmental, health, maintenance, cost, aesthetic perspectives.

The perks entail decreased energy consumption, reduced chemical exposure, lower water wastage, heightened aesthetics, and easier maintenance. Nevertheless, they come with upfront costs of installation and require a slightly nuanced approach to design.

Added Value of Sustainability

Incorporating eco-friendly elements into your pool design is not just good for the environment, but it also adds significant value to your property. It provides a unique selling point if you decide to sell your home, with more homeowners seeking sustainable homes.

Additionally, eco-friendly pools are cost-effective in the longer run due to the reduced maintenance and running costs. Plus, they contribute towards creating a healthier living environment for you and your family.

The Aesthetic Edge

Going 'Eco' with your pool doesn't mean you sacrifice the design aesthetic. Natural pools, a popular eco-friendly option, can be designed to mimic beautiful aquatic ecosystems. They provide a visually appealing and bio-diverse environment, bringing nature right to your backyard.

Even traditional pools with eco-friendly functionalities can be made visually stunning with conscious design choices. Efficient designs can enable the pool to blend seamlessly with your garden and home design.

Choosing the Right Eco-friendly Pool Design

Choosing to go eco-friendly with your pool design does not mean a 'one size fits all' approach. There are various options available depending on your needs and constraints.

Are you looking for a more natural swimming experience? A natural pool could be the right choice. Are you looking for an aesthetically pleasing oasis that fosters native fauna? A bio pool could be the perfect solution. Or perhaps, improving the efficiency of your current pool is on the agenda? Solar Blankets or efficient pool pumps could find a place in your backyard sanctuary.
